Paneer Delight: A Mouthwatering Recipe for the Perfect Indian Cheese Dish

 

Paneer is a popular Indian cheese that is often used in vegetarian dishes. Here is a recipe for a basic paneer dish that can be used as an entree or side dish:



Ingredients:

·         Paneer (400 grams), cut into cubes

·         Onion (1 medium), finely chopped

·         Tomatoes (2 medium), finely chopped

·         Ginger-garlic paste (1 tablespoon)

·         Green chili (1), chopped

·         Cumin seeds (1/2 teaspoon)

·         Turmeric powder (1/2 teaspoon)

·         Red chili powder (1/2 teaspoon)

·         Coriander powder (1 teaspoon)

·         Garam masala powder (1/2 teaspoon)

·         Salt to taste

·         Oil for cooking

·         Fresh coriander leaves, chopped (for garnish)

 

Instructions:

·         Heat oil in a pan and add cumin seeds. Once they start to crackle, add chopped onions and sauté until they turn golden brown.

·         Add ginger-garlic paste and green chili to the pan and sauté for a minute.

·         Add chopped tomatoes, turmeric powder, red chili powder, coriander powder, garam masala powder, and salt to the pan. Mix well and cook until the tomatoes become soft and the mixture turns into a thick paste.

·         Add paneer cubes to the pan and mix well so that the paneer gets coated with the tomato-spice mixture.

·         Cook for a few minutes until the paneer is heated through and the flavors have blended together.

·         Garnish with fresh coriander leaves and serve hot with naan, roti or rice.

·         This basic paneer recipe can be easily modified by adding other vegetables such as bell peppers or green peas, or by adjusting the spices to suit your taste preferences. Enjoy!
